New medical report on Bolsonaro, hospitalized in ICU for bronchopneumonia
Former Brazilian President Jair Bolsonaro remains "stable" in intensive care for bacterial pneumonia, although he has shown a deterioration in kidney function...

TL;DR
- Jair Bolsonaro is hospitalized in intensive care for bacterial pneumonia.
- He is clinically stable, but his kidney function has deteriorated and inflammatory markers have increased.
- The pneumonia resulted from a bronchoaspiration episode, a recurring issue related to a past stabbing.
- Bolsonaro is undergoing treatment with antibiotics and respiratory physiotherapy.
- He is currently serving a prison sentence for attempting to stay in power after the 2022 elections.
- Despite being imprisoned, Bolsonaro remains a significant figure in Brazilian politics ahead of the October elections.
